Our Mission

  • To support and speak on behalf of children and youth in the schools, in the community and before governmental bodies and other organizations that make decisions affecting children;
     
  • To assist parents in developing the skills they need to raise and protect their children;
     
  • To encourage parent and public involvement in the public schools of this nation. “

    “everychild.onevoice”


We support the McMullen-Booth Elementary Mission Statement, which reads:

McMullen-Booth Elementary will provide the best possible educational experience which results in highest student achievement for all through the unified efforts of the school, parents and community.

At McMullen-Booth Elementary, we put Children First!
